Comprehending Storm Windows


Before diving into repairs, it's valuable to comprehend what storm windows are and their advantages. Storm windows are normally set up on the exterior or interior of a home's primary windows, providing an added layer of protection against severe climate condition.

Advantages of Storm Windows

Benefit

Description

Weather condition Protection

Shields primary windows from strong winds, rain, and snow

Energy Efficiency

Decreases cooling and heating expenses by decreasing drafts

Sound Reduction

Reduces external sound, producing a quieter indoor area

UV Protection

Secures interior furnishings from fading due to sunshine

Improved Security

Adds an extra barrier against possible break-ins

Typical Issues with Storm Windows


Like any other part of a home, storm windows can come across issues. Here are some typical issues house owners might face:

Problem

Description

Cracked or Broken Glass

Damage due to extreme weather condition or effects

Weakening Seals

Seals may deteriorate gradually, leading to drafts

Rust and Corrosion

Metal frames might rust, negatively impacting functionality

Sticking or Misalignment

Windows may become tough to open or close

Distorted Frames

Changes in temperature level and humidity can warp window frames

2. Can I repair my storm windows myself?

A lot of storm window repairs can be completed DIY-style, specifically for small concerns like seal replacements or lubrication. However, for extensive damage, professional aid might be a good idea.

3. What materials last the longest for storm windows?

Vinyl and fiberglass storm windows are known for their durability and resistance to weather-related damage.

4. Is it worth repairing storm windows?

Yes, fixing storm windows can extend their life, enhance energy efficiency, and make sure the comfort of your home, making it a beneficial financial investment.

5. When should I think about replacing my storm windows?

If the frame is significantly deformed, the glass is completely shattered, or the window is old and ineffective, it may be more economical to change instead of repair.
